I used to get a lot of clicking in my knees just through everyday movement. It was actually painful to squat at all, eve without weights.
I saw a physio in the spring, which got me exercising my knees more, and the clicks went away.
Basically it was the muscles/tendons being too tight over my knee joints, and simply using them stretched them out.
If the problem persists, I'd get checked, but it'll probably clear up if you keep excercising properly.0
